The Essence of Tropes

Literary tropes are like the building blocks of narratives. They are recurring patterns that writers use to convey certain ideas or evoke specific emotions. Think of them as the familiar elements that make stories resonate with audiences across cultures and time periods. ๐ŸŒ

Breaking Down Tropes

Now, let's dissect the anatomy of a trope. At its core, a trope is a storytelling shortcut. It's a recognizable convention or device that both writers and audiences understand. Whether it's the hero's journey, the love triangle, or the unexpected twist, tropes provide a common language for storytellers. ๐Ÿ”„

Common Tropes and Their Impact

Let's delve into some popular tropes and examine their influence on literature:

The Hero's Journey ๐Ÿฆธ

The hero's journey is a timeless trope that follows a protagonist through a series of stages, from the ordinary world to the extraordinary. From Harry Potter to Frodo Baggins, this trope provides a template for character development and epic adventures.

Love Triangle ๐Ÿ’”

A classic trope that adds a layer of complexity to romantic narratives. Love triangles inject tension and emotion into the plot, forcing characters and readers alike to navigate the complexities of love, loyalty, and heartbreak.

Plot Twist ๐Ÿ”„

Who doesn't love a good plot twist? This trope subverts expectations, keeping audiences on the edge of their seats. From "The Sixth Sense" to "Gone Girl," the plot twist is a powerful narrative device that can redefine an entire story.

Embracing and Subverting Tropes

Writers often face the challenge of balancing the comfort of tropes with the need for originality. Some choose to embrace tropes wholeheartedly, creating stories that celebrate familiar themes. Others prefer to subvert expectations, using tropes as a canvas for unexpected twists and unconventional narratives. ๐ŸŽญ

Striking the Balance

Successful storytelling often lies in finding the right balance. Tropes can be a foundation on which to build, but it's the author's creativity that breathes life into them. Striking the perfect balance ensures a narrative that feels both timeless and refreshingly new. โš–๏ธ
